Sweden's e-sports heritage
We have a rich history of success in e-sports, from legendary players like Emil "HeatoN" Christensen in Counter-Strike to the Alliance's great success in Dota 2. Our deep gaming culture, strong infrastructure and extensive support make Sweden a fertile ground for competitive gaming.
Tournaments to look forward to
There are many major esports tournaments planned in Sweden in late 2024. The weekend of 22-24 November will be packed with action as several competitions take place. Whether you follow Counter-Strike 2, Overwatch 2 or other e-sports titles, this weekend offers something for all players and spectators.
Swedish Elite Series Autumn 2024
Sweden's premier Counter-Strike 2 tournament, Svenska Elitserien Höst, will take place in Stockholm on 22-24 November 2024, bringing together Sweden's best teams to compete for national glory and international recognition.
DreamHack Winter 2024
DreamHack Winter, which takes place in Jönköping on 22-24 November 2024, is one of the world's largest digital festivals. Featuring tournaments in games such as CS2, League of Legends and Fortnite, the festival is a real highlight for both Swedish and international gaming fans.
OWCS season finals 2024
The Overwatch Contenders Series (OWCS) Season Finals are also held in Sweden on the same weekend. This marks the end of the Overwatch 2 season where the best teams from around the world compete for the championship title.
